How to Make Malibu Baked Chicken
- Preheat the oven to 350°F. Once the chicken is pounded evenly, place them in a lightly coated 9×13″ baking dish (or a baking dish that fits the chicken).
- Sprinkle half of the Chupacabra Cluckalicious seasoning over the chicken, flip, add the rest of the seasoning, and flip again.
- Bake for ~20-25 minutes or until the internal temp reads 150°F. Remove the pan from the oven, place a couple of slices of ham on top, followed by the strips of cheese.
- Pop the pan back into the oven and bake until the cheese is melted and the internal temp reads 165°F.

How to Store and Reheat Baked Malibu Chicken
Once the chicken is cooled, storing it and reheating it is a breeze.
Storage: Once cooled, place the chicken in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 3 days.
Reheating:
- Oven: Preheat the oven to 350°F, place the chicken on a rimmed baking sheet, cover loosely with foil to prevent drying out, and heat for ~10 minutes or until warmed through. *You may need to add a bit more cheese in case it sticks to the foil.
- Microwave: While I’m not a massive fan of using it, you can reheat it quickly this way. Place the chicken on a plate, cover it loosely with plastic wrap, and heat it in 30-second intervals until warm.

Breaded Malibu Chicken Breasts
You’ll need the following additional ingredients:
- 2 eggs, beaten
- 1 cup all-purpose flour
- 1 1/2 teaspoons Chupacabra Cluckalicious Seasoning *You won’t add the seasoning amount in the recipe card.
- 1 3/4 cup panko bread crumbs
- Canola oil for frying (pan-fried only) or olive oil spritz for oven-baked
Pan-Fried Breaded Chicken
- Pour a 1/4″ of canola in a heavy-bottomed pan, turn to medium.
- Beat the eggs and put them in a pan to coat the chicken. In another bowl, mix the flour and seasoning; set aside. In a third dish, add the panko.
- Place the chicken into the flour pan, coating the chicken on all sides. Place the floured chicken into the egg wash, flipping to coat evenly. Please pick up the chicken, allowing the excess to drip off, then transfer it to the panko pan, coating all sides.
- Place the chicken into the hot oil (350°F) and cook just until it’s golden brown (Do not cook all the way through). You want the chicken to read ~150°F. Remove from the oil and transfer it to a cooling rack sitting in a paper towel-lined sheet pan to allow the oil to drip off. Repeat until all the chicken is fried.
- Place the chicken in a baking dish, top with the ham and cheese, and bake in a pre-heated 400°F oven for ~10 minutes or until the cheese is melted and the internal temperature reads 165°F.
Oven-Baked Breaded Chicken :
- Preheat the oven to 400°F.
- Beat the eggs and put them in a pan to coat the chicken. In another bowl, mix the flour and seasoning; set aside. In a third dish, add the panko.
- Place the chicken into the flour pan, coating the chicken on all sides. Place the floured chicken into the egg wash, flipping to coat evenly. Please pick up the chicken, allowing the excess to drip off, then transfer it to the panko pan, coating all sides.
- Generously spray the coated chicken with olive oil and place it on a rimmed baking sheet. Bake for about 15-18 minutes or until the internal temp reads 150°F.
- Remove from the oven, top with the ham and cheese, and place back in the oven for ~10 minutes or until the cheese is melted and the internal temperature reads 165°F.
Baked Malibu Chicken Recipe
Juicy, perfectly seasoned chicken breasts are topped with savory sliced ham, melted Swiss cheese, and paired with a creamy homemade honey mustard sauce that takes it over the top. It’s the perfect weeknight meal that tastes like it came straight from a restaurant
- Prep Time: 10 minutes
- Cook Time: 30 minutes
- Total Time: 40 minutes
- Yield: 4 servings
- Category: chicken dinner, easy weeknight meals, dinner party, cheesy chicken, budget-friendly dinner
- Method: Oven
- Cuisine: chicken dinner, easy weeknight meals, dinner party, cheesy chicken, budget-friendly dinner
Ingredients
- 4 Chicken Breasts – boneless, skinless, and pounded to an even thickness
- 1 1/2 teaspoons Chupacabra Cluckalicious
- 8–12 slices of Black Forest Deli Ham
- 4–8 1/4″thick slices of Swiss Cheese
Instructions
- Preheat the oven to 350°F. Once the chicken is pounded evenly, place them in a lightly coated 9×13″ baking dish (or a baking dish that fits the chicken).
- Sprinkle half of the Chupacabra Cluckalicious seasoning over the chicken, flip, add the rest of the seasoning, and flip again.
- Bake for ~20-25 minutes or until the internal temp reads 150°F. Remove the pan from the oven, place a couple of slices of ham on top, followed by the strips of cheese.
- Pop the pan back into the oven and bake until the cheese is melted and the internal temp reads 165°F.
